Cushing Syndrome

Confirm autonomous hypercortisolism before localization, then use ACTH to separate adrenal from pituitary or ectopic disease. Surgical cure is preferred, but urgent cortisol control, source-directed imaging, petrosal sampling, and medical bridging are essential when disease is severe or surgery is not curative.

Clinical question: How should physicians confirm, localize, stabilize, and treat endogenous hypercortisolism?

Immediate priorities

Identify patients needing urgent cortisol control

Severe hypercortisolism can require treatment before definitive source control.

Urgently assess patients with florid or rapidly progressive hypercortisolism for complications that alter immediate management: severe hypertension, hypokalemia, edema, hyperglycemia, infection, thrombotic risk, neuropsychiatric deterioration, and cardiovascular symptoms. Obtain blood pressure, electrolytes, glucose, renal function, liver tests, and a resting ECG; pursue additional cardiovascular testing or imaging when symptoms or examination suggest cardiac disease. When hypercortisolism is life-threatening, surgery is delayed, or surgery is not feasible, begin a rapid cortisol-lowering strategy rather than waiting for definitive treatment. For UFC greater than 5 but less than 10 times the upper limit of normal without life-threatening complications, higher-dose, relatively rapid-acting steroidogenesis-inhibitor monotherapy with osilodrostat, metyrapone, or ketoconazole and serum cortisol and/or UFC reassessment every 5-7 days is one recommended approach; block-and-replace therapy is an alternative. Correct clinically consequential hypokalemia, edema, and hypertension concurrently. Mineralocorticoid-receptor blockade can be effective for these manifestations, including during mifepristone, metyrapone, or osilodrostat therapy; avoid eplerenone with mifepristone because mifepristone increases eplerenone exposure. Biochemical confirmation

Confirm hypercortisolism before imaging

Testing is most useful when clinical probability justifies evaluation.

First exclude exogenous corticosteroid exposure, the most common cause of Cushing syndrome. In patients with persistent clinical suspicion after that review, confirm endogenous hypercortisolism using late-night salivary cortisol, a 1-mg overnight dexamethasone suppression test, and/or 24-hour urinary free cortisol. For the overnight dexamethasone suppression test, administer dexamethasone 1 mg orally between 11 PM and midnight and measure serum cortisol between 8 AM and 9 AM the next morning. A morning cortisol below 1.8 micrograms/dL indicates normal suppression; failure to suppress requires confirmatory assessment in the clinical context. Use tests of cortisol excess—not pituitary or adrenal imaging—as the first localization gate. Hypercortisolemia must be established before attempting etiologic differentiation, because incidental pituitary and adrenal lesions can misdirect management. Pseudo-Cushing states and discordant tests

When clinical findings and first-line testing remain equivocal, do not proceed directly to source-directed surgery. Dynamic CRH and desmopressin testing with combined ACTH and cortisol interpretation has been studied to distinguish Cushing disease from pseudo-Cushing states, but should be used as a specialized adjudication tool rather than a replacement for initial biochemical confirmation. Etiologic branching

Use ACTH to direct adrenal versus pituitary or ectopic evaluation

ACTH is the pivotal branch point after biochemical confirmation.

Measure plasma ACTH after endogenous hypercortisolism is confirmed. Suppressed ACTH indicates ACTH-independent cortisol excess and should redirect imaging and management to the adrenal glands; nonsuppressed ACTH indicates ACTH-dependent disease requiring pituitary-versus-ectopic source assessment. An ACTH concentration above 20 ng/L establishes ACTH dependence in the Endotext diagnostic framework. Intermediate values are a gray zone because pituitary Cushing disease and adrenal pathology can overlap; repeat assessment and integrate the biochemical pattern rather than assigning etiology from a single indeterminate ACTH value. In ACTH-dependent Cushing syndrome, obtain gadolinium-enhanced pituitary MRI before invasive sampling. MRI detects only approximately 40%-52% of corticotroph tumors, so a negative study does not exclude Cushing disease. ScienceDirectEvaluation and treatment of Cushing’s syndrome - ScienceDirect

When to perform inferior petrosal sinus sampling

Perform bilateral inferior petrosal sinus sampling (BIPSS) in confirmed ACTH-dependent hypercortisolism when pituitary MRI is negative or inconclusive, especially with a lesion smaller than 6 mm, or when noninvasive tests do not reliably distinguish pituitary from ectopic ACTH secretion. BIPSS is the reference invasive discriminator for central versus nonpituitary ACTH secretion. During BIPSS, obtain bilateral petrosal and peripheral ACTH samples before and after CRH or desmopressin stimulation. A central-to-peripheral ACTH ratio greater than 2 before stimulation or greater than 3 after stimulation supports Cushing disease; prolactin measurement can help verify adequate catheter placement. Source control

Prioritize resection, then select salvage therapy by source and urgency

Definitive treatment is removal of the cortisol- or ACTH-producing lesion whenever feasible.

Surgical resection of the causative pituitary, adrenal, or ectopic neuroendocrine tumor is primary treatment for endogenous Cushing syndrome. For Cushing disease, transsphenoidal pituitary surgery is first-line; reported initial remission is approximately 70%-90% for microadenomas and 50%-65% for macroadenomas. accessdata fda202107Orig1s000 - accessdata.fda.govBMJCushing syndrome - Symptoms, diagnosis and treatment | BMJ Best Practice USPubMedTreatment options for Cushing disease after unsuccessful ...

After persistent or recurrent Cushing disease, choose among repeat pituitary surgery, pituitary radiotherapy, medical therapy, and bilateral adrenalectomy according to localization, resectability, urgency of cortisol control, and patient preference. Medical therapy is also appropriate when surgery or radiotherapy is not feasible, in metastatic disease, or as a bridge when severe hypercortisolism requires immediate control. accessdata fda202107Orig1s000 - accessdata.fda.govOxford AcademicTreatment of Cushing's Syndrome: An Endocrine Society ...PubMedUpdate and Practical Recommendations for the Use of Medical Treatment of Cushing Syndrome

For adrenal cortisol excess, manage as an ACTH-independent source with adrenal-directed definitive treatment when an operable lesion is identified. For ectopic ACTH secretion, pursue resection of the ACTH-secreting tumor when feasible; steroidogenesis inhibitors can control cortisol excess regardless of source while localization, surgery, or oncologic treatment proceeds. Selecting and monitoring medical therapy

Select a cortisol-lowering drug according to desired speed of control, disease severity, comorbidity, and adverse-effect profile. Metyrapone lowers cortisol rapidly, with trough cortisol levels reported approximately 2 hours after a dose; maintenance therapy is usually 750-6000 mg/day in 3-4 divided doses. Patients with adrenal tumors may be sensitive to lower doses, whereas Cushing disease often requires higher doses. PubMedCushing’s Syndrome - Endotext - NCBI Bookshelf

Monitor ketoconazole and levoketoconazole for gastrointestinal adverse effects, hepatotoxicity, and QT-interval prolongation, particularly when coadministered with another QT-prolonging medication. Monitor metyrapone and osilodrostat for hypokalemia, edema, and hypertension; monitor all effective cortisol-lowering regimens for biochemical and clinical hypocortisolism. Mifepristone requires clinical rather than cortisol-based assessment of glucocorticoid receptor blockade and carries a boxed warning for antiprogestational effects that can terminate pregnancy. Do not combine mifepristone with eplerenone. Follow-up

Monitor for remission, recurrence, and treatment-related adrenal insufficiency

Biochemical response and complications require longitudinal reassessment after source-directed treatment.

After pituitary surgery, interpret follow-up in the context of postoperative adrenal function and recurrent hypercortisolism risk. Initial surgery does not cure every patient, particularly macroadenomas, so persistent signs or biochemical evidence of cortisol excess should prompt reassessment for residual pituitary disease, ectopic ACTH secretion, or an incorrect initial localization. accessdata fda202107Orig1s000 - accessdata.fda.gov

Patients receiving medical therapy require serial assessment of cortisol control and drug toxicity. During rapid dose adjustment for substantial cortisol excess, repeat serum cortisol and/or UFC every 5-7 days; evaluate blood pressure, potassium, edema, liver tests, ECG/QT risk, and symptoms of hypocortisolism according to the selected agent. If bilateral adrenalectomy is chosen after failure of pituitary-directed approaches, it provides definitive adrenal cortisol control but does not treat the pituitary ACTH source; plan long-term endocrine follow-up and surveillance for progressive corticotroph tumor behavior. accessdata fda202107Orig1s000 - accessdata.fda.govOxford AcademicTreatment of Cushing's Syndrome: An Endocrine Society ...

Common questions

When is inferior petrosal sinus sampling unnecessary in ACTH-dependent Cushing syndrome?

BIPSS may be omitted when pituitary MRI and noninvasive testing convincingly support Cushing disease. Use it when MRI is negative or equivocal, particularly with a lesion smaller than 6 mm, or when pituitary versus ectopic ACTH secretion remains uncertain. Can steroidogenesis inhibitors be used before the source is fully localized?

Yes. Adrenal steroidogenesis inhibitors reduce cortisol production regardless of cause and are useful when severe hypercortisolism requires prompt control during localization, before surgery, after surgical failure, or while awaiting radiotherapy effect.
